An Interns Training & Development program on “UNDERSTANDING AUTISM AND ITS INTERVENTIONS” was led by our Founder & Executive Director Ms. Sumana Dutta. Students from diverse academic backgrounds from within and outside Bangalore including MSW, MSc Clinical & Counselling Psychology, and Bachelor’s in Physiotherapy.
Our interns from Kristu Jayanti University, Columbia Group of Institutes, and Marian College, Kuttikanam engaged in thoughtful discussions that deepened their understanding of autism, evidence-based interventions, and the real-life nuances of working within neurodiverse communities.
More than a knowledge-sharing program, this initiative strengthened practical insight, professional sensitivity, and interdisciplinary collaboration among emerging practitioners. By bridging academic learning with field realities, it contributed meaningfully to building a more informed, empathetic, and inclusion-driven workforce.
This reflects Akshadhaa’s continued commitment to capacity building and shaping future professionals who can create lasting impact in the field of neurodevelopment and mental health.
